What kind of fire pit is most secure? Very first issues initial: “Examine with your local fire Section to determine the restrictions for fire pits in backyards,” claims Alex Kantor, operator of Ideal Plants Nursery. “It is important to be aware of the expectations and specifications to avoid wasting time, dollars, and energy developing a fire pit that does not comply with polices.” Framework and materials are naturally key when searching for a Risk-free fire pit, as well. “Steer faraway from nearly anything that feels as well mild or flimsy because it’ll probable be at risk of wobbling, making it unsafe, In particular all over men and women and Animals,” states Joanna Humphreys, fire and stove pro for Direct Stoves. “If you’re dealing with genuine fire and flames, you may need your firebase for being as robust as is possible in order to avoid fire spreading and producing unwanted accidents dangers of outdoor fire pits to Other individuals and also harm to your back garden.”  Finally, come up with a program for wherever the fire pit will sit inside your backyard or in a campsite. “Stay clear of placing fire pits in flammable parts, such as wooden decks or in the vicinity of thick brush,” Kantor suggests.

We to begin with imagined that there may very well be a measurable functionality big difference among smokeless fire pit designs: one of the most smoke eliminated through the secondary combustion. But just after various months of screening, we discovered that every one the pits worked kind of the exact same.

But in the event you realize that the accompanying smoke dampens that enjoyment, or If the neighbors choose to continue to keep their Bed room Home windows open up to capture the cool air, you may consider using a so-referred to as smokeless fire pit, which removes some (but not all) of the fire’s smoke and almost all of the ash.
